Tomoaki Teshima
|
7294ae0f17
|
fix test failure of StereoBeliefPropagation
* if the src has odd number of height, access error happens
* it could happen on width, too
* check both dst and src range in both width and height
|
2018-10-04 08:35:34 +09:00 |
|
Alexander Alekhin
|
fc59498b2b
|
cuda: fix build
use cv::AutoBuffer::data() to get data pointer
|
2018-07-06 15:32:36 +03:00 |
|
Tomoaki Teshima
|
c14578649d
|
fix build error on Jetson
|
2018-03-28 18:21:53 +09:00 |
|
Rok Mandeljc
|
bf5e930468
|
cudastereo: drawColorDisp: enabled CV_32S and CV_32F disparity formats
|
2015-11-19 11:05:13 +01:00 |
|
Rok Mandeljc
|
9f82ac18d4
|
cudastereo: reprojectImageTo3D: enabled CV_32S and CV_32F disparity formats
This is to achieve parity with the CPU equivalent.
|
2015-11-19 11:05:13 +01:00 |
|
Rok Mandeljc
|
eb3cb77296
|
Fixes for compiling with CUDA 6.5
Based on commit feb74b125d from 2.4.9 branch.
|
2014-08-29 23:09:02 +02:00 |
|
Ernest Galbrun
|
6207d338dd
|
merged new master branch
changed tests for tvl1 optflow
correction of a bug preventing compilation with cuda (fmin changed to fminf)
|
2014-08-18 15:29:45 +02:00 |
|
Aaron Denney
|
4644689d5a
|
And remove final vestiges.
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
85601e03dd
|
remove constant memory use in compute_data_cost
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
52516085d9
|
remove constant memory from init_data_cost
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
1ff270e41c
|
init_message no longer uses constant memory.
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
9b8002cd43
|
remove use of constant memory in calc_all_iterations/compute_message/message_per_pixel
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
b792419cde
|
Remove compute_disp()'s use of constant memory.
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
6d86d63ac5
|
Last of csbp load_constants() gone.
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
9bc71f4cb6
|
Deconstify minimum disparity.
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
eed5cbc5db
|
More constant removal.
|
2014-07-17 09:43:21 -07:00 |
|
Aaron Denney
|
3ab117df04
|
Change struct with single static function to function.
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
021b0cb4d5
|
Pass max_disc_term as kernel parameter.
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
0e2ea45c93
|
ndisp no longer constant
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
2832cfdfe5
|
No longer use constant memory for image step.
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
d8d946a458
|
Constify cuda csbp
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
2982e77495
|
Pass in images and scratch space so that multiple copies can run concurrently.
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
fe29ed461c
|
Move shared interface to header file rather than repeating.
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
e532bd50d5
|
Move shared interface to header file rather than repeating.
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
1533d0448f
|
cdata_weight always positive; fewer multiplications.
|
2014-07-17 09:43:20 -07:00 |
|
Aaron Denney
|
d848704b35
|
cuda::DisparityBilateralFilter no longer uses constant memory for parameters
Now multiple filters can be used in the same context without stepping on each other.
|
2014-07-17 09:43:20 -07:00 |
|
Kyrylo Shegeda
|
d37d46d279
|
Fix a typo in kernel size
|
2013-10-11 23:31:31 -04:00 |
|
Vladislav Vinogradov
|
0c7663eb3b
|
Merge branch 'master' into gpu-cuda-rename
Conflicts:
modules/core/include/opencv2/core/cuda.hpp
modules/cudacodec/src/thread.cpp
modules/cudacodec/src/thread.hpp
modules/superres/perf/perf_superres.cpp
modules/superres/src/btv_l1_cuda.cpp
modules/superres/src/optical_flow.cpp
modules/videostab/src/global_motion.cpp
modules/videostab/src/inpainting.cpp
samples/cpp/stitching_detailed.cpp
samples/cpp/videostab.cpp
samples/gpu/stereo_multi.cpp
|
2013-09-06 15:44:44 +04:00 |
|
Vladislav Vinogradov
|
429bfad225
|
removed precomp.cpp files
|
2013-09-02 14:00:44 +04:00 |
|
Vladislav Vinogradov
|
fd88654b45
|
replaced GPU -> CUDA
|
2013-09-02 14:00:44 +04:00 |
|
Vladislav Vinogradov
|
71d61e07b1
|
renamed gpustereo -> cudastereo
|
2013-09-02 14:00:42 +04:00 |
|